Acemetacin Stada 60 mg Hard Gelatin Capsules

COMPOSITION Each hard gelatin capsule contains: Acemetacin 60 mg. PHARMACEUTICAL FORM Hard gelatin capsule. PHARMACOLOGICAL ACTION Acemetacin is a glycolic acid ester of indomethacin and the pharmacological activity resulting from acemetacin administration in man is derived from the presence of both acemetacin and indomethacin. The precise pharmacological mode of action of acemetacin is not known. …

Leponex [Clozapine] Tablets – Antipsychotic Agent

COMPOSITION Leponex 100: Clozapine 100 mg. Leponex 25: Clozapine 25 mg. PHARMACOLOGY Absorption: Rapid and nearly complete. Distribution: Rapid and extensive, crosses blood-brain barrier. Duration of action: 4 to 12 hours. Elimination: Renal 50%, Fecal 30%. Clozapine has little or no effect on serum prolactin. Extrapyramidal effects are reported to be rare or absent. INDICATIONS …

Teracin [Terazosin] Oral tablets: Benefits, Risks & FAQs

Teracin is a brand name for the medication terazosin, which belongs to the class of drugs called alpha-1 blockers. It is primarily used to treat hypertension (high blood pressure) and ben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H), a condition where the prostate gland enlarges and causes urinary problems in men.
